Doha, Qatar: In a commendable effort to promote environmental sustainability and raise awareness about plastic waste reduction, the General Cleanliness Department at the Ministry of Municipality, in association with Al Wakrah municipality and LuLu Hypermarket, successfully conducted a waste sorting programme from the source.
This event was part of an awareness campaign aligned with World Plastic Bags Free Day, held at LuLu Hypermarket Ezdan Oasis on July 1 and 2.
The primary objective of this initiative was to educate the public on the importance of reducing plastic bag usage and to encourage the proper sorting of waste, especially plastics, into recycling containers. As part of the campaign, LuLu Hypermarket distributed reusable bags and gifts to participants, demonstrating their commitment to sustainable practices. Notably, LuLu Hypermarket has long been a proponent of environmental responsibility, consistently using biodegradable bags in their stores.
During the event, municipality officials engaged with customers, providing valuable information on the proper sorting of waste into designated containers and the correct disposal of plastics. This educational effort is part of the Ministry of Municipality’s broader initiative to reduce plastic use and foster environmental awareness within the community.
A few months ago, the Ministry of Municipality, represented by the General Cleanliness Department, launched the second phase of the waste sorting at source program. This phase involves the provision of specialized containers to households in various areas for the separate disposal of recyclable materials and organic waste. Blue containers are designated for recyclable materials such as glass, plastic, papers, and metals, while grey containers are for food waste and cleaning materials.
